US Anti-War Groups Rally against “Oil War” on Venezuela
DID Press: US anti-war organizations issued an urgent call for nationwide protests in response to escalating tensions and what they describe as “America’s war against Venezuela.” The ANSWER coalition announced that the demonstrations aim to denounce recent U.S. actions in the region.

“This war is not about drugs; it is not about democracy. It is about looting Venezuela’s oil and asserting dominance over Latin America,” the coalition underlined in the statement.
The statement condemned recent operations as “a brutal escalation of a campaign of killings in international waters and piracy targeting civilian vessels trading with Venezuela.”
ANSWER urged Americans to take to the streets to oppose “another endless war,” noting that the U.S. public does not want further military conflicts.
According to the organization, within the first hour of the announcement, 13 U.S. cities were already scheduled to host protest gatherings, including a demonstration at the White House at 1 p.m. Additional cities are expected to be announced soon.
